- trialware
nearly identical in meaning; emphasises the time-limited nature of the trial
- demo software
often shorter and with limited features, not necessarily requiring payment afterward
- evaluation copy
slightly more formal; used in business software contexts
- freeware
completely free, no payment required at any stage
- open-source software
free in terms of access to source code, not necessarily free of cost, but the distribution model is fundamentally different

用法筆記
Shareware is an uncountable noun in standard English. It is frequently used attributively before other nouns (e.g. 'shareware program', 'shareware version'). Do not confuse with 'freeware', which is completely free with no payment required at any stage, or 'open-source software', where users can access and modify the source code.
